Lamar Moves Up; Southeastern and SFA Enter Week 7 National Polls

FRISCO – Lamar remains ranked in the FCS Top 25 polls, while Southeastern and Stephen F. Austin joined the Cardinals in the national rankings, as announced Monday by both organizations.

Lamar made another strong climb in both polls, breaking into the Top 20 after securing its fifth straight win. The Cardinals moved up three spots to No. 17 in the Stats Perform poll and six spots to No. 18 in the AFCA Coaches Poll. Lamar rallied for a 33-23 road victory over East Texas A&M and will now turn its attention to hosting UTRGV in Beaumont on Saturday.

Southeastern entered the AFCA Coaches Poll at No. 22 despite being idle last week and is receiving the second-most votes among teams outside the Top 25 in the Stats Perform poll. The Lions return from their open week to host Northwestern State at Strawberry Stadium on Saturday afternoon.

Stephen F. Austin re-entered the Stats Perform Top 25 at No. 25 and is receiving the third-most votes in the AFCA Coaches Poll. The Lumberjacks also come off a bye week and will welcome Nicholls to Homer Bryce Stadium on Saturday.

UTRGV continues to receive votes in the AFCA Coaches Poll as the Vaqueros sit at 5-1 overall. They will travel to Beaumont to take on nationally ranked Lamar.
